The recent buzz surrounding Google Firebase hosting suspension has raised serious questions about security. How can we ensure our Firebase projects aren't inadvertently contributing to malware distribution? What coding best practices can we implement to mitigate these risks? Let's dive in.

One of the most pressing issues is the potential for attackers to exploit Firebase Hosting to bypass security measures and distribute malicious content. This often happens when developers aren't diligent about input validation or properly sanitizing user-generated content. I remember one project where we allowed users to upload custom HTML templates. We quickly realized we had to implement rigorous checks to prevent them from injecting malicious <script> tags. It was a hard lesson learned, but it highlighted the importance of a defense-in-depth approach.


To combat these threats, here are a few coding best practices I've found invaluable:

  1. Strict Input Validation: Always validate user inputs on both the client-side and server-side. Use regular expressions and whitelists to ensure that only expected data is accepted. For example, if you're expecting a number, make sure it's actually a number and within a reasonable range.
  2. Content Security Policy (CSP): Implement a strong Content-Security-Policy header in your Firebase Hosting configuration. This allows you to control the sources from which the browser is allowed to load resources, effectively preventing the execution of unauthorized scripts. I've found that setting a strict CSP can drastically reduce the attack surface of your application.
  3. Regular Security Audits: Conduct regular security audits of your Firebase projects. Use automated tools and manual code reviews to identify potential vulnerabilities. Consider hiring a security expert to perform penetration testing.
  4. Stay Updated: Keep your Firebase SDKs and dependencies up to date. Security vulnerabilities are often discovered and patched in newer versions, so it's crucial to stay current. I once spent an entire weekend debugging a strange issue only to realize I was using an outdated version of the Firebase SDK with a known vulnerability.
